怎么查看一个exe程序的源代码

用什么软件,能提供下载地址或教程吗?

1、需要百度下载一个jad.exe的工具包,放到个人jdk版本的主目录下的bin目录下。

2、同时需要把下载下来的一个名为net.sf.jadclipse_3.3.0.jar的jar包复制到eclipse->plugins目录下。

3、打开eclipse 在window->preferences 下对工具jadClipse进行配置。

4、最后还需要修改eclipse的配置方式File Associations ,找到 .class 文件,并把jad设为 .class文件的 默认打开方式。

5、最后可以看到 jad工具配置成功后  ,eclipse 显示成功,以String.class为例。

6、Java Decompiler 是一个jar包查看的绿色工具,无需eclipse便可直接打开并查看 jar包内容,点击OK即可查看任何一个exe程序的源代码

温馨提示:答案为网友推荐,仅供参考
第1个回答  2019-06-30

1、右键点击页面空白地方,然后点击菜单上的‘显示网页源代码’。

2、点击后,就会在新标签上打开显示网页的代码了。

3、如果你只要查看某个部分的源代码,我们可以先在网页上该部分控件上右键点击,然后点击‘检查’。

4、点击后,就会在浏览器下方显示出该部分所在的代码了。

本回答被网友采纳
第2个回答  推荐于2017-11-26
有很多反编译软件但是 目前的那些效率比较低下,而且不是什么样的exe程序都可以反编译的要看编码的语言你可以去百度一下eXeScope(下载地址 http://www.onlinedown.net/soft/9594.htm)这个工具你可以试试 祝你好运~本回答被网友采纳
第3个回答  2018-03-02
exe的产生可以有若干途径。

绝大多数编译型语言产生的exe,你是无法查看源代码的,否则全球的程序员都失业了。

尽管你无法查看源代码,但可以有一些反汇编或跟踪方式,同样可以局部的,一定程度的了解exe所做的事情。
楼上说的脱壳只是反汇编或跟踪的一个前提。距离查看源代码还很远很远。

逆向工程是一个复杂的学问,非三言两语可以说清。
第4个回答  2013-09-06
反编译 但是 不要用做商业用途 ,, 非法的
相似回答